
Evergreen Court’s Closure: A Heartfelt Transition for Seniors
In a bittersweet announcement, the Goshen Care Center Joint Powers Board and Vetras Healthcare revealed that Evergreen Court senior living in Torrington will be closing its doors on August 30, 2025. This decision, while difficult, arises from the need for substantial building renovations that have become financially impractical.
Understanding the Impact of Evergreen Court’s Closure
The closure will affect a small community, with only five residents currently living at Evergreen Court. Each of these individuals will be provided with personalized relocation assistance and emotional support services, ensuring that this transition is as smooth and compassionate as possible. The emphasis on care during this change reflects the organization’s commitment to the well-being of its residents.
Transitioning to New Opportunities in Senior Living
It's important to highlight that the closure of Evergreen Court does not affect the nearby Evergreen Plaza Assisted Living Facility. This facility will continue to welcome those seeking independent or assisted living arrangements, providing options that ensure residents can maintain their desired quality of life.
